Understanding Common Samsung Freezer Problems


Samsung freezers are generally reliable, but like any appliance, they can develop faults over time. Knowing the typical problems helps you spot issues early and decide if you can fix them yourself or need professional help.


  • Freezer not cooling properly: This is the most common complaint. It could be due to a dirty condenser coil, a faulty thermostat, or a broken compressor.

  • Frost buildup: Excessive frost can block airflow and reduce efficiency. It often points to a defrost system failure.

  • Strange noises: Buzzing, clicking, or humming sounds might indicate a failing fan motor or compressor.

  • Water leakage: This can happen if the defrost drain is clogged or the door seal is damaged.

  • Freezer runs constantly: If your freezer never seems to turn off, it might be struggling to maintain temperature due to a faulty sensor or poor door seal.


Understanding these issues helps you take the right steps to fix your Samsung freezer without unnecessary delays.

How to Troubleshoot Your Samsung Freezer


Before calling a repair service, there are some simple checks you can do yourself. These steps often solve minor problems and save you time and money.


  1. Check the power supply

    Make sure the freezer is plugged in securely and the outlet is working. Try plugging in another device to confirm power.


  2. Inspect the door seal

    A damaged or dirty seal lets cold air escape. Clean the seal with warm soapy water and check for cracks or tears. Replace if necessary.


  3. Clean the condenser coils

    Dust and dirt on the coils reduce cooling efficiency. Unplug the freezer and use a vacuum or brush to clean the coils at the back or underneath.


  4. Defrost the freezer

    If frost buildup is visible, turn off the freezer and let the ice melt. Avoid using sharp objects to chip away ice as this can damage the unit.


  5. Check the temperature settings

    Sometimes the thermostat is accidentally set too high. Adjust it to the recommended temperature, usually around -18°C for freezers.


  6. Listen for unusual sounds

    If you hear strange noises, try to locate the source. A noisy fan or compressor may need professional attention.


If these steps don’t fix the problem, it’s time to consider professional Samsung freezer repair.


When to Call a Professional for Samsung Freezer Repair


Some freezer issues require expert knowledge and tools. Attempting complex repairs without experience can cause more damage or void your warranty. Here are signs you should call a professional:


  • The freezer is not cooling despite your troubleshooting.

  • You notice electrical issues like sparks or burning smells.

  • The compressor or fan motor is making loud or unusual noises.

  • Water is pooling inside or outside the freezer.

  • The freezer cycles on and off rapidly without maintaining temperature.


Professional technicians can diagnose the problem accurately and fix it on-site, often the same day. This saves you from the hassle of replacing the entire unit prematurely.

Maintaining Your Samsung Freezer for Long-Term Performance


Once your freezer is repaired, keeping it in good shape is easier than you think. Regular maintenance prevents many common problems and extends the life of your appliance.


  • Clean the condenser coils every 6 months

Dust buildup reduces efficiency and strains the compressor.


  • Check door seals regularly

Clean and inspect seals to keep cold air inside.


  • Avoid overloading the freezer

Proper airflow inside the freezer helps maintain even temperatures.


  • Defrost when frost exceeds 0.5 cm

Excess frost blocks airflow and wastes energy.


  • Keep the freezer away from heat sources

Avoid placing it near ovens or direct sunlight.


  • Monitor temperature settings

Keep the freezer at the recommended temperature for optimal food preservation.


By following these simple steps, you can avoid many common freezer issues and enjoy peace of mind.
